> Thanks to yesterday's bug report by Kristof Petr (send on private), I have
> fixed the strange problem that was causing clamd crashes, especially in
> highly loaded environments. The problem was in missing closedir() in error
> conditions in directory recursive scanners in clamd and libclamav (clamscan
> was also affected) which was causing a descriptor leak. The fix makes clamd
> completely stable in my stress tests. A stable version will be released
> on Friday. If there are some things you want to be included in the final
> version, please let us know immediately.
